Slightly related. Has anyone found a source for a ready made saddle for the X7 nylon?
Working with mine I need something 76mm x 3.4mm x 10mm or so. I started with the Macnichol bone for fender accoustic that I think is 75 x 3.2 x 12 or so and it's ok but sloppier fit than I would like. |

I was looking more for the definition of what it is and where to find one pre made but it looks like the X7 nylon is not a common size for the saddle. Macnichol was saying that he can't do that one. Bob from Colosi is going to make a custom one as a copy of my stock. I was more hoping it someone had identified a place that had non custom options. Less for the money and more as I like the learning aspect. |
